GIRL ALEX EGGS
My first morning in Paris, Girl Alex made eggs for breakfast and the herbs made them taste unlike any I had ever had before. The secret is butter, Albert Menes rosemary, fleur de sel, and mad skillet skills. The Albert Menes rosemary is really special and makes everything taste good. It's sold both in the Grand Epicerie and the Franprix, it's a right not a luxury.
A French Breakfast
Heat a generous amount of butter in a pan. Crack up to 4 eggs into the hot butter. Let cook, then flip, don't be afraid to cut them apart and mush them into each other a little. Salt, pepper, season generously with Albert Menes rosemary. Slip onto plates while yolk is still runny.
Serve with warm toast dolloped with more butter and spread with Bonne Maman framboise confiture. Use toast as an eating vehicle and to sop up any yellow yolk that runs onto the plate. Delicious alongside a Mariage Freres blue flower, earl gray tea that only has a hint of the bergamot and blends wonderfully with a drop of milk.
Don't worry about the fact that French people do understand toasting fresh bread. They only toast old bread.
